Vin Gupta

Affiliate Assistant Professor

Vin Gupta, MD, MSt, MPA is a practicing pulmonologist and Managing Director of Health Innovation at Manatt. Prior to his current role, Dr. Gupta served as Chief Medical Officer of Pharmacy and New Health Initiatives at Amazon for over six years; prior to this he helped build the Apple 6 watch as part of the Apple Clinical team. Additional ongoing responsibilities include serving as a medical analyst for NBC News and MSNBC, as affiliate faculty at the University of Washington’s Institute for Health Metrics and Evaluation and Evans School, and as an officer (Major) in the United States Air Force Reserve Corps.

Dr. Gupta received his Bachelor of Arts degree from Princeton University, Medical Doctorate from Columbia University’s Vagelos College of Physicians and Surgeons, Master in Public Administration from Harvard’s Kennedy School of Government, and Master of Studies in International Relations from the University of Cambridge. He has active board certification in Internal Medicine, Pulmonology, and Critical Care Medicine and completed his clinical training at Brigham & Women’s Hospital. Dr. Gupta is a life member of the Council on Foreign Relations and serves on the Board of Directors of HIMSS and the American Lung Association.
